Bopup IM Suite is a secure real-time communication software designed to provide efficient and private Instant Messaging (IM) over networks of any size. This software is based on a client/server architecture that meets most of the critical business needs, such as centralized management, the Active Directory (LDAP) support, message and file transfer logging. One of the innovations in the Microsoft Windows 2000 and the NTFS 5.0 file system was the Encrypting File System (EFS) technology, which is designed to quickly encrypt files on the computer hard drive.
